Name: Ilkka-Eemeli Laari
Nickname: I-E, Ile
Born: May 29th, 1989
Hometown: Siilinjärvi, Finland
Sport: Snowboarding
Started snowboarding: I started snowboarding in 1995. I was six years old when my mom bought me a snowboard and took me to a ski instructor. After a few times I was on my own.
Home away from home: I try to make myself at home wherever I am. A friend’s couch can be a home when necessary.
Greatest career achievement so far: My greatest career achievement so far has been getting back into snowboarding after two serious injuries last winter.
First trick you were really proud of: A dub haakon in a pipe. I was the first Finn to land it and I was so happy and could feel the massive amount of adrenaline going through me. Pure awesomeness.
